Big Labor announces a $100 million campaign to save the Democrat majority in Congress and Democrats start the process of enacting campaign reform that does not apply to labor unions. Republicans have offered amendments to close the labor loophole but to no avail. The “DISCLOSE” bill will move to the House floor for a vote with the labor loopholes — and that is no accident.
